#714305 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#714305 is composed of 44.3% red, 26.3%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 40.7% magenta, 95.6%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 34.4 degrees, a saturation of 91.5% and a lightness of 23.1%. #714305 color hex could be obtained by blending #e2860a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#714305
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#fef7ed is the lightest one.

Tones of #714305
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3f3c37 is the less saturated color, while #764400 is the most saturated one.
